The purpose of the Iroquois League was ___________________________. a. to create a trade alliance between the Comanche and the D

akota c. to create an agricultural alliance among groups in the north to ensure food in winter months b. to unite the Hopi and the Zuni against the Acoma d. to unite the eastern and south eastern Native American groups in defense against the European colonists Please select the best answer from the choices provided A B C D
History
1 answer:
stealth61 [152]3 years ago
7 0

Answer:

Option: d. to unite the eastern and south eastern Native American groups in defense against the European colonists.      

Explanation:

The Iroquois League is the oldest form of representative government in America. The league formed by five American Indian tribes included Cayuga, Mohawk, Oneida, Seneca, and Onondaga. It founded before the arrival of European in America. The purpose of this league was to unite and promote peace and understanding among several different tribes. Later it shifted to defend themselves against the European colonists who were taking away their land.
